diff --git a/debugger/watchesdlg.pp b/debugger/watchesdlg.pp index ce20def8a7..b6d7b92ac2 100644 --- a/debugger/watchesdlg.pp +++ b/debugger/watchesdlg.pp @@ -1028,7 +1028,7 @@ begin else tvWatches.NodeText[VNode, COL_WATCH_VALUE-1]:= ''; - if (DebugBoss.Debugger <> nil) and (DebugBoss.Debugger.State <> dsRun) and + if (DebugBoss <> nil) and (DebugBoss.State <> dsRun) and (WatchValue <> nil) and (WatchValue.Validity <> ddsRequested) then begin TypInfo := WatchValue.TypeInfo;